Automatic continuously variable positive mechanical transmission with adjustable centrifugal eccentric weights and method for actuating same

1. An automatic continuously variable positive mechanical transmission comprising:

  • a transmission case (64) supporting an input shaft (30), an output shaft (31) and defining a point of support (35,

         48);

    a positive kinematic link comprising a first planetary gear train (44) linking the input shaft to the output shaft, said positive kinematic link being at least partially supported by said point of support (35,

         48);

    torque compensation means comprising eccentric weights (51,

         61) subject to centrifugal forces for producing torque on a first set of planet wheels and a second set of planet wheels in the first planetary gear train;

    wherein the first set of planet wheels and the second set of planet wheels are carried by a common planet wheel carrier (E);

    the first set of planet wheels (1,

         3) engages with at least one toothing (2,

         4) which forms said point of support (35,

         48), said first set of planet wheels is influenced by a first centrifugal device (36) being provided with eccentric weights (51);

    the second set of planet wheels (11, 13,

         15) engages with planet wheels (12, 14,

         16) linked respectively to the input shaft (30) and to the output shaft (31) and is coupled with a second centrifugal device (37) being provided with eccentric weight (61);

    said first and second centrifugal devices (36,

         37) comprise, on a planet wheel of the first and the second sets of planet wheels, a secondary planetary gear train (5, 6, 49;

    9, 10,

         59), and secondary planet wheels (5,

         10) of each secondary planetary gear train are linked to the eccentric weights (51,

         61) and rotate at a speed equal to that of the common planet wheel carrier (E); and

    the eccentricity of the weights are adjustable during operation of the automatic continuously variable positive mechanical transmission.
